目的 :通过观察脑胶质瘤中 p16mRNA及其蛋白、EGFR的表达 ,探讨其在脑胶质瘤发生、发展中的作用。 方法 :应用原位杂交技术和免疫组织化学方法在 38例人脑胶质瘤中检测 p16mRNA及其蛋白、EGFR的表达。以 7例正常组织作为对照。结果 :p16mRNA和 p16蛋白在Ⅲ~Ⅳ级、Ⅰ~Ⅱ级胶质瘤、正常组织中的阳性表达率分别为 8 3% ,16 7% ;5 7 7% ,5 7 7% ;71 4% ,85 7%。EGFR在Ⅲ~Ⅳ级、Ⅰ~Ⅱ级胶质瘤、正常组织中的阳性表达率分别为 83 3% ,38 5 % ,14 3%。结论 :p16基因缺失引起的 p16蛋白的表达降低、EGFR的过表达在脑胶质瘤的发生中起重要的作用。
